Gracedale, Luzerne County

Gracedale, a charming township nestled in Luzerne County, Pennsylvania, is a hidden gem waiting to be discovered. With its rich history and natural beauty, Gracedale offers visitors a tranquil escape from the bustling city life. Located in the northeastern region of the United States, Luzerne County is known for its picturesque landscapes, friendly communities, and vibrant culture.

Gracedale is situated in the heart of Luzerne County, offering visitors convenient access to the county’s various attractions and amenities. The township itself is known for its warm hospitality and welcoming atmosphere, making it an ideal destination for both locals and tourists alike.

One of the main draws of Gracedale is its proximity to the city of Wilkes-Barre, the county seat of Luzerne County. Wilkes-Barre is a vibrant city that offers a wide range of entertainment options, including theaters, museums, shopping centers, and exciting nightlife. Visitors can explore the fascinating history of the city at the Luzerne County Historical Society Museum or catch a show at the F.M. Kirby Center for the Performing Arts.

In addition to Wilkes-Barre, Gracedale is also close to several other towns and attractions worth exploring. Just a short drive away is the charming town of Dallas, which is known for its quaint shops, beautiful parks, and historic sites. Nature enthusiasts will also appreciate the proximity to Ricketts Glen State Park, a stunning natural wonderland offering miles of hiking trails and breathtaking waterfalls.

For those looking to indulge in some retail therapy, the Wyoming Valley Mall, located in nearby Wilkes-Barre Township, is a popular shopping destination. With its wide selection of stores, restaurants, and entertainment options, the mall provides a perfect day out for visitors of all ages.

Gracedale’s proximity to the Pocono Mountains, one of Pennsylvania’s most famous natural attractions, adds to its appeal. Outdoor enthusiasts can take advantage of the township’s close proximity to the mountains and enjoy activities such as hiking, biking, skiing, and fishing. The Pocono Raceway, known for its thrilling NASCAR races, is also just a short drive away.
